Nurse Practitioner - Eugene, OR Compensation: $52.
54 - 78.
80 per hour and more Overview: Nexus HR is looking for a Nurse Practitioner in the Eugene, Oregon area.
The ideal Nurse Practitioner, along with a multidisciplinary clinical team, provides initial and ongoing clinical assessment for patients with advanced and/or progressive medical conditions who are referred to hospice and palliative care.
Client-highlighted qualifications - Current Oregon licensure as a Nurse Practitioner.
Current CPR certification, prescriptive drug privileges, and DEA license.
About the Job Assist in the evaluation and treatment of patients receiving hospice and palliative care in the community or at the Pete Moore hospice house.
The nurse practitioner conducts patient interviews, collects, and interprets diagnostic data.
Performs physical examinations and specialized procedures under the delegation of the Medical Director.
Makes house calls for chronically ill adults at the patient’s place of residence and the Pete Moore Hospice House.
Works collaboratively with the Medical Director and shares weekend and evening call coverage.
Duties and Responsibilities: Perform bedside palliative care delivery for patients.
Apply a variety of clinical skills, including health status assessment, screening for disease, provision of appropriate treatment, education, and healthcare guidance to patients.
Diagnose, treat, and manage acute and chronic health conditions.
Order, perform, and interpret laboratory and radiology tests within the scope of professional practice.
Ensure complete and timely patient care documentation according to regulations.
Perform comprehensive adult and geriatric exams, adjust medications, establish treatment plans, educate residents and nursing staff, coordinate care, work collaboratively, facilitate family meetings, participate in coordinated care rounds, and assist with discharge planning for optimal patient outcomes.
Prescribe medications, including controlled substances, to the extent delegated and licensed.
Perform therapeutic or corrective measures as indicated, including urgent care assessment and treatment.
Consult with an interdisciplinary team, including the Medical Director, or designee, as needed.
Inform primary physician, specialists, and care team of services provided, collaborating with others, as needed.
Provide quality clinical services in a caring, respectful manner, with a solid patient-oriented bedside manner.
Exhibit a talent for cultivating a positive, supportive, and energetic team atmosphere.
Stand, sit, walk, or utilize other means of mobility within a clinic setting.
Assist patients with mobility in preparation for examinations or treatment needs.
Demonstrate a strong computer proficiency with knowledge of EMR documentation and utilities.
Function within the Scope of Practice for Nurse Practitioners outlined by the Oregon State Board of Nursing.
Assist with additional duties and responsibilities as assigned.
Qualifications: 2 years of experience working with clinic experience with a hospice and palliative care background preferred.
Must be a graduate of an accredited school of professional nursing with advanced training as a family or emergency nurse practitioner.
Verbal and written communication, problem-solving, and decision-making, with expertise in planning and organizing.
Ability to assess and effectively resolve difficult situations.
Ability to maintain a high standard of professionalism in all activities undertaken in a diversity of clinical environments with both patients and family/caregivers.
Ability to work independently, as well as within a team framework.
Must be a licensed Nurse Practitioner in the state of Oregon.
Must have a CPR certification.
Must have a DEA license Authorized to work in the US.
Benefits: Dental Vision Medical 401k Paid Leave Others
